mirror of https://github.com/twbs/bootstrap.git
				
				
				
			fixes #9538: prevent Firefox rendering bug via some border-fu
This commit is contained in:
		
							parent
							
								
									0e39f94574
								
							
						
					
					
						commit
						0c70744ea2
					
				|  | @ -2473,6 +2473,7 @@ textarea.input-group-sm > .input-group-btn > .btn { | |||
|   vertical-align: middle; | ||||
|   border-top: 4px solid #000000; | ||||
|   border-right: 4px solid transparent; | ||||
|   border-bottom: 0 dotted; | ||||
|   border-left: 4px solid transparent; | ||||
|   content: ""; | ||||
| } | ||||
|  | @ -2591,7 +2592,7 @@ textarea.input-group-sm > .input-group-btn > .btn { | |||
| 
 | ||||
| .dropup .caret, | ||||
| .navbar-fixed-bottom .dropdown .caret { | ||||
|   border-top: 0; | ||||
|   border-top: 0 dotted; | ||||
|   border-bottom: 4px solid #000000; | ||||
|   content: ""; | ||||
| } | ||||
|  |  | |||
										
											
												File diff suppressed because one or more lines are too long
											
										
									
								
							|  | @ -13,6 +13,9 @@ | |||
|   border-top:   @caret-width-base solid @dropdown-caret-color; | ||||
|   border-right: @caret-width-base solid transparent; | ||||
|   border-left:  @caret-width-base solid transparent; | ||||
|   // Firefox fix for https://github.com/twbs/bootstrap/issues/9538. Once fixed, | ||||
|   // we can just straight up remove this. | ||||
|   border-bottom: 0 dotted; | ||||
|   content: ""; | ||||
| } | ||||
| 
 | ||||
|  | @ -161,7 +164,9 @@ | |||
| .navbar-fixed-bottom .dropdown { | ||||
|   // Reverse the caret | ||||
|   .caret { | ||||
|     border-top: 0; | ||||
|     // Firefox fix for https://github.com/twbs/bootstrap/issues/9538. Once this | ||||
|     // gets fixed, restore `border-top: 0;`. | ||||
|     border-top: 0 dotted; | ||||
|     border-bottom: 4px solid @dropdown-caret-color; | ||||
|     content: ""; | ||||
|   } | ||||
|  |  | |||
		Loading…
	
		Reference in New Issue